Digital HCP Digital Marketing is a division of Digital HCP New Media, a digital marketing and Internet development agency. The company was established in July 2001 by founding partners John Phillips, Darren Chalton and Matt Wilkinson. It has seen rapid growth since its inception, with turnover doubling year on year.

 

The company offers a complete package of advanced technical solutions, including Search Engine Optimisation, Pay Per Click Campaign development and management, E-mail marketing, SMS / MMS business applications, web-based tools and e-business applications to Interactive DVD development, Intranet development and on-line marketing.

During the summer of 2003 the company created an alliance with successful new media consultancies Chinese Media and New Europe. The merger brings together some of the most prominent names from the Internet industry. Former Hostmenow founders Tariq Ahmed (CFO) and Rob Bonnet were appointed to the HPC board, as was Ed Rose, founder and MD of JKL, the electronic publishing arm of the Daily Telegraph.

Our clients range from regional SME's to national and international blue chips, as well as numerous public sector organisations.
